Southeast Arizona Overview

Southeast Arizona is arguably the most famous birding region in the United States. Its unique "Sky Island" mountain ranges rise dramatically from the Sonoran and Chihuahuan deserts, creating isolated forested habitats that harbor Mexican species found nowhere else in the US.

Key Habitats & Highlights

  • Madera Canyon: A legendary hotspot for the Elegant Trogon, Elf Owl, and numerous hummingbird species.
  • Cave Creek Canyon (Chiricahua Mountains): The premier location to find the elusive Montezuma Quail and the stunning Mexican Chickadee.
  • Patagonia-Sonoita Creek: Essential riparian habitat famous for the Violet-crowned Hummingbird and Gray Hawk.
  • Ramsey Canyon Preserve: Often called the "Hummingbird Capital of the United States," hosting up to 14 species of hummingbirds.

Seasonal Guidance

  • Breeding & Monsoon Season (May to August): Considered the absolute peak for Southeast Arizona. The late summer rains trigger a "second spring," bringing out a dazzling array of hummingbirds and breeding flycatchers.
  • Spring Migration (March to May): Excellent for early northbound migrants moving through the riparian corridors and canyons.
